Output 177f8a80679c901b48a6753d830d359a54faf7ef3a0bfc23ea0f5da19e2d4bca:2

value
574183
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2390e815ae65a8a3367186f8add0dedb5c846a04 OP_EQUALVERIFY OP_CHECKSIG
address
14F4EzzMrbt5QBijZNjPWwMMRYJXRM2cYn
transaction
177f8a80679c901b48a6753d830d359a54faf7ef3a0bfc23ea0f5da19e2d4bca
confirmations
221103
spent
true